Cuphea ignea, commonly known as the cigar plant or firecracker plant, is a subshrub or shrub native to Mexico and parts of the Caribbean. It is known for its tubular, bright red flowers that resemble lit cigars. This plant thrives in wet tropical climates and is often used in gardens for its vibrant color and attractiveness to hummingbirds and butterflies.

Instructions d'entretien
Cuphea ignea requires bright, direct sunlight for optimal growth. It prefers moderate temperatures and high humidity. Water the plant regularly to keep the soil evenly moist but not waterlogged. This plant can be grown both indoors and outdoors, making it versatile for various settings.
Sol
Cuphea ignea prefers well-draining loamy soil that retains moisture without becoming waterlogged. Ensure the soil is rich in organic matter to support its nutrient needs. Good drainage is essential to prevent root rot.
Engrais
Use a balanced fertilizer with an N-P-K ratio of 10-10-10. Fertilize the plant every 4-6 weeks during the growing season to support its vibrant growth and flowering.
Rempotage
Repot Cuphea ignea every 1-2 years or when it outgrows its current pot. Choose a slightly larger pot with good drainage. Gently remove the plant from its old pot, loosen the roots, and place it in the new pot with fresh soil.
Propagation
Propagate Cuphea ignea through stem cuttings. Take cuttings in the spring or early summer, dip the cut end in rooting hormone, and plant it in a well-draining soil mix. Keep the soil moist and provide bright, indirect light until roots develop.
Taille
Prune Cuphea ignea regularly to maintain its shape and encourage bushier growth. Remove any dead or damaged branches and trim back leggy growth. Pruning can be done throughout the growing season.
Toxicité
Cuphea ignea is not known to be toxic to pets or humans. However, it is always a good practice to keep plants out of reach of pets and children to avoid any accidental ingestion.
Supplémentaire
Cuphea ignea is a great addition to gardens and landscapes for its continuous blooming and ability to attract pollinators. It can also be grown in containers, making it a versatile plant for various gardening needs.
